KDC has two corporate build-to-suit projects underway in Legacy West including a 265,000-square-foot headquarters complex for FedEx Office and Toyota’s North American Headquarters.In addition Chase just announced adding a complex consolidating 10,000 jobs to this area.And just up the highway is the Grandscape development including Nebraska furniture mart.Building on 400+ acres, we are virtually a city within the center of the Dallas/Fort Worth market, an epicenter of growth, in the 4th largest metropolitan area in the nation.And we are attracting the biggest, boldest and brightest names in retail, starting with Nebraska Furniture Mart of Texas, a retail powerhouse that by itself will attract a projected 8 million shoppers a year.Our grand plans for Grandscape include more than just one-of-a-kind retail: Convention center hotel and spaUnique restaurantsAn outdoor amphitheaterAnd more.So this area is still very active, both for sales and building.
